Some News:
Today i had a great success in solving the problem with this f.... Bolt for the camshaft.
It turned out, that the bolt which is needed for the 99 camshaft is not available in UAE and i had to wait for minimum 10 days more.
My initial plan to modify the existing screw i dropped, because this screw if it fails, could damage the whole engine ( too much risk ).
So i decided to change the camshaft into a 94 model ( as the block is also 94 ).
Al Jallaf had the right camshaft together with the right Sprocket and Bolt, yeah.
I went back to 7 P with the new camshaft and they will finish the engine now until monday or tuesday. Due to some other works which came in for them during my search for the screw the last couple of days, i only can bring the car now on saturday morning for the engine swap. They will need two days for the swap.
Power Pack i am coming !!!
